Transaction 2856167334fdaa2e132d010f041fb6cc7014de09c11299dcd06b227098d50b87

1 Input
2 Outputs
  • 2856167334fdaa2e132d010f041fb6cc7014de09c11299dcd06b227098d50b87:0
  • value  154614
    address  3KQQ7viLYjXQ1jPs8UL2odfWjqYCuvksGY
  • 2856167334fdaa2e132d010f041fb6cc7014de09c11299dcd06b227098d50b87:1
  • value  614905577
    address  33WEZ6dCiXpxAs3UjeE5veTAyStoBgfJHJ